REALISATIONS CLES ATTENDUES
• Dans son domaine, instruit les études d'opportunité en apportant la vision moyen et long terme.
• Réalise ou pilote les études de faisabilité : solutions possibles, coûts, délais, risques.
• Fait ou fait faire les études d’intégration, instruit les demandes d’évolutions liées aux écarts en respectant le processus de management entité.
• Participe à la réalisation, l’installation et le démarrage des équipements et à la formation des équipes en collaboration avec ses partenaires.
• Les validations (CI, RF, RC) sont obtenues après les phases de réalisation, d’installation, de démarrage et mise au point des équipements faites en collaboration avec les métiers connexes de l’industrie.
• Fournit le dossier nécessaire à l’intégration, l’exploitation et à la maintenance de l’équipement sur site.
• Garantit ses engagements en SMQDC et veille au respect de la réglementation défini dans le cadre de la vulnérabilité SI.
• A la fin du déploiement, assure la mise à jour des dossiers en fonction des évolutions suite à mise au point ou modifications de l’équipement et capitalise dans le plan de déploiement générique les bonnes pratiques.
• Pour assurer la continuité business de ses applications, assure pour son domaine d’application, le support technique et fonctionnel selon le processus support de l’entité.

As the leading mobility company, we work with tires, around tires and beyond tires to enable Motion for Life. Dedicated to enhancing our clients’ mobility and sustainability, Michelin designs and distributes the most suitable tires, services and solutions for our customers’ needs. Michelin provides digital services, maps and guides to help enrich trips and travels and make them unique experiences. Bringing our expertise to new markets, we invest in high-technology materials, 3D printing and hydrogen, to serve a wide a variety of industries—from aerospace to biotech. Headquartered in Greenville, South Carolina, Michelin North America has approximately 23,000 employees and operates 34 production facilities in the United States and Canada.

MICHELIN® tires have been ranked the #1 Tire Brand across major categories and segments by industry experts and consumers alike. For nearly three decades we’ve been recognized for our achievements in Customer Satisfaction, Performance, Durability, Technology and Innovation.
